Image Processing

Colorbar

An implementation of digital image processing to generate Colorbar (Colormap) for screen test.

Content

Requirements

  • Python
  • OpenCV apt install python-opencv

Programming

  • create file colorbar.py
import numpy as np
import cv2 

# Create a black image
img = np.zeros((80,560,3), np.uint8)

cv2.rectangle(img,   (0,0),  (80,80), (0xC0, 0xC0, 0xC0), -1)  # gray (BGR)
cv2.rectangle(img,  (80,0), (160,80), (0x00, 0xFF, 0xFF), -1)  # yellow
cv2.rectangle(img, (160,0), (240,80), (0xFF, 0xFF, 0x00), -1)  # cyan
cv2.rectangle(img, (240,0), (320,80), (0x00, 0xFF, 0x00), -1)  # green
cv2.rectangle(img, (320,0), (400,80), (0xFF, 0x00, 0xFF), -1)  # magenta
cv2.rectangle(img, (400,0), (480,80), (0x00, 0x00, 0xFF), -1)  # red
cv2.rectangle(img, (480,0), (560,80), (0xFF, 0x00, 0x00), -1)  # blue
cv2.imwrite('colorbar.png',img)

Running

  • Running colorbar.py
    # python ./colorbar.py
